The idea of electing sheriffs is just colossally stupid.
Why? It makes way more sense than having it be an appointed position that's not accountable to voters directly.
Also, the sheriff is really just the manager of the deputies. So you're directly electing the manager of the people enforcing the laws against you.
Having an armed elected official that can start criminal investigations/parallel construction into any one challenging them in an election is a shit idea is why.
Them running an election campaign while solving crime is a shit idea. Having to create election donation rules around the conflict of interest to donating to a sheriff's campaign or not or only rich can run a campaign et cetera is group of shite ideas.
Because LEO should not be in representative government.
They should be appointed by the county council to a term of four years. They should be easily removed because do we or don't we believe in public sovereignty and sheriffs usually bend to kings rather than a republic.
